General Dentist – Lexington, South Carolina

Position Summary

A growing privately owned dental practice (not part of a DSO) in Lexington is seeking a General Dentist to join its collaborative and patient-focused team. This opportunity offers strong earning potential, a supportive clinical environment, and the ability to provide comprehensive dentistry within a modern practice that values autonomy, mentorship, and long-term professional growth. The practice is open to dentists at all experience levels who are motivated to develop their clinical skills while building lasting patient relationships.

Compensation & Benefits

  • $800 daily guarantee or greater, transitioning to 30% of production
  • Fee-For-Service practice with limited PPO participation
  • Company-paid lab fees
  • $10,000 production bonus in the first year
  • Medical coverage provided
  • IRA with 3% employer match
  • Continuing Education allowance
  • Established patient flow with strong production opportunity

Schedule

  • Monday – Thursday: 8:00 AM – 5:00 PM
  • Friday: 8:00 AM – 1:00 PM
